제목
Sodium Ion Flexible battery in Poly-Acrylic Acid with Vinyl Silica Nano Particle grafted Gel Electrolyte

Sodium ion Battery(SIB) has much interesting due to abundance of sodium in earth's crust and low cost. To improve the performance of SIB with gel electrolyte, the poly-Acrylic Acid (PAA) cross-linked with Vinyl Silica Nano Particle (VSNP) was used as gel electrolyte hamper electrode material dissolution. The VSNP was used as cross-linker and synthesized by Sol-Gel method with Vinyltriethoxysilane (VTES) to improve the mechanical strength of gel. Fourier-Transform Infrared Spectroscopy (FTIR) and Scanning Electron Microscope (SEM) was used to analyze C=C bond and morphology of VSNP. PAA gel was polymerized by radical polymerizaiotn with VSNP cross-linker. Electrochemical Impedance Spectroscopy (EIS) was used to analyze interfaces-contact with electrode and electrolyte. After measure electrochemical property, X-ray Diffraction was measured to characterize the NVP crystallinity. By this research, It can propose the way how apply to flexible sodium ion flexible battery and gel electrolyte
